PSALM LXVII.

[God on us His grace bestow]

God on us His grace bestow,
His freely-pardoning grace;
Bless us from our sins, and show
The brightness of His face!
Let Thy way on earth be shown;
Thee let every sinner find,
Make the great salvation known
To us, and all mankind.
Let the people praise Thee, Lord,
The God of truth and grace;
Thee, the everlasting Word,
Let all the people praise!
O give thanks, rejoice, and sing,
Every creature under heaven;
Let them triumph in their King,
And shout their sins forgiven.
Thou shalt judge the nations right,
Thy equal sway maintain;
Rule them by Thy mercy's might,
And bless them by Thy reign.
Let the people praise Thee, Lord,
Thee, the God of truth and grace!
Thee, the everlasting Word,
Let all the nations praise!

Then to perfect holiness
The earth her fruit shall have;
God, our God, His saints shall bless,
And to the utmost save.
God shall perfect us in one;
Then the world their Lord shall see,
Thee the nations all shall own,
And give their hearts to Thee.
